The station at Tonbridge is well-equipped to meet the needs of its travelers. Ticket purchases and collections are made easy with a ticket office open from early morning to late evening throughout the week and at multiple ticket machines available on-site. The station is also smartcard compatible, offering modern convenience to regular commuters.
Comfortable and accessible travel is a priority at Tonbridge. The station boasts step-free access throughout, making it an inclusive environment for everyone. Passenger assistance is readily available, and staff can be contacted through help points stationed around the platform. Furthermore, there are accessible toilets and heated waiting rooms open during staffing hours to keep you comfortable and warm while you wait for your train.
No journey is complete without a stop for refreshments, and Tonbridge Station has its passengers covered with a variety of options. Food and drinks can be purchased from the buffet areas on the platforms, while vending machines offer quick snacks for those in a hurry. Don’t worry if you need to top up on cash; an ATM is conveniently located at the station. However, do note that public Wi-Fi isn't currently offered, so ensure you come prepared if you require internet access during your wait.
If you're driving to the station, parking is facilitated by APCOA Parking, with ample spaces available 24 hours daily. Accessible parking spaces are also set aside for those in need. Cycling enthusiasts will be pleased to find 220 cycle spaces and Brompton Dock’s bicycle hire service, ideal for a green commute or a leisurely ride around town.

While there is no ticket office at Brunstane, passengers can conveniently purchase and collect tickets using the available ticket machines. Those who prefer to buy tickets online can easily collect them from these machines, which are designed to be accessible, including for those using mobility aids, ensuring a smooth experience for everyone.
Brunstane station is equipped with departure screens and loudspeaker announcements to keep travelers informed about train schedules. Although no dedicated staff is on-site to offer assistance, help points are strategically placed for immediate support. Furthermore, passengers with hearing aids will find induction loops available at the station.
Accessibility is a priority, with step-free access available to a single platform, making travel easier for anyone with mobility impairments. However, you might want to plan ahead if requiring facilities like ramps or accessible toilets, which are not available at Brunstane. Customer service support can be reached via email, and lost property inquiries can be handled through ScotRail’s resources.
Traveling to and from Brunstane continues to be easy and efficient. If rail services are replaced by buses, these can be caught at the nearby Milton Road East bus stop, as detailed on What3Words. For those looking to explore more of Edinburgh through public transport, Traveline Scotland offers comprehensive details on local bus services. Taxi options are also available, and further details can be found on TrainTaxi’s website.
